drm/panfrost: Introduce huge tmpfs mountpoint option
Introduce the 'panfrost.transparent_hugepage' boolean module parameter (false by default). When the parameter is set to true, a new tmpfs mountpoint is created and mounted using the 'huge=within_size' option.
